Synopsis:

In a world irrevocably altered by the appearance of seven celestial fragments, a clandestine organization known as MET emerges. Founded by pioneering scientists Dr. Mishina and Dr. Kishiwada, MET aims to harness the power of these enigmatic shooting stars – each possessing potent, desire-fueled abilities – to maintain global stability. Their central tool is the "Musumet," a large helmet capable of amplifying human potential to extraordinary levels.

Following Dr. Mishina's death, his daughters – Aoi, Midori, and Kurenai – dedicate themselves to continuing their father’s work. They operate as masked agents, utilizing Musumet to confront threats while navigating the complexities of everyday life. Their missions often require them to blend into various environments, from school hallways to disaster zones, presenting a unique duality between extraordinary power and ordinary adolescence. The series explores themes of responsibility, sacrifice, and the challenges of balancing duty with personal aspirations.
